Nonfiction Reading: Expository Texts
Common Core Nonfiction Reading Skills
The proficient nonfiction reader...
o Asks relevant questions (who, what, where, when, why, and how) about the text.
o Answers questions using key details from the text.
o Determines meaning of general academic and domain-specific words and phrases.
o Explains main idea and supports answer with key details from the text.
o Uses specific language (cause/ effect, sequence) to describe the sequence of events.
o Demonstrates understanding through use of images, illustrations, or words from text.
o Explains how specific image contributes to understanding of text.
o Uses text features (e.g. glossary, table of contents, headers) to locate information quickly and efficiently.
